Amazon CEO orders 5-day office return
Briefly

Andy Jassy mandated a return to the office five days a week starting January, emphasizing that this change aims to reduce management layers and enhance operational efficiency.
Jassy acknowledged the challenges of returning to the office for some employees, saying, 'We understand that some of our teammates may have set up their personal lives in such a way that returning to the office consistently five days per week will require some adjustments.'
Highlighting the need to address bureaucracy, Jassy stated, 'Keeping your culture strong is not a birthright... You have to work at it all the time.'
To streamline operations, Jassy's directive includes a 15% increase in the ratio of individual contributors to managers by March 2025, along with a bureaucracy tipline for employees.
